Samir Bhandari, Co-founder, CFO, hBits
“The RBI’s decision to cut the repo rate by 25 bps to 6.25 % for the first time in 5 years underscores its commitment to financial stability while balancing inflation and growth. This is particularly significant for commercial real estate investors, as it ensures access to capital at predictable costs, allowing for long-term strategic investments in premium assets. With inflationary pressures moderating and liquidity remaining steady, investor confidence in structured real estate investments, including fractional ownership, is expected to strengthen. At hBits, we see this as a positive shift, as more institutional and retail investors look for stable, inflation-hedged assets with strong rental yields. Given the global economic uncertainties, commercial real estate remains a resilient and income-generating asset class, and the RBI’s policy direction will play a key role in shaping future investment trends in this space.”
Viram Shah, Founder & CEO, Vested Finance
“RBI’s decision to cut rates is in line with expectations. The dovish stance follows most global major central banks that have also cut rates or have shown an indication to do so. The rate cut will likely further narrow the US-India bond yield spread which is already at a 20-year low, making the US bonds more attractive for foreign investors. This may lead to more outflows in coming months leading to investments in US bonds and stock markets. A weak rupee also makes a case for investing in US markets as investors will benefit from the strong dollar. At the time the Indian market has been struggling, investors should consider investing in global equities, especially US-listed, as they may not just provide alpha but also help diversify their portfolio. Domestic focused stocks in the US, such as utilities, steelmakers, etc. look attractive.”

RBI Monetary Policy Commentary by Sakshi Gupta, Principal Economist, HDFC Bank

In the inflation-growth trade-off, the RBI tilted towards supporting growth by cutting the policy rate by 25bps today. This decision was underpinned by the governor’s emphasis on the “flexibility” in the inflation target framework, a deviation from the previous assertion of reaching the median target of 4% by the central bank.
While the policy rate was reduced, the MPC kept the stance unchanged at neutral. This could imply a more cautious approach toward the extent of rate cuts going forward in this rate-cutting cycle.
The stance also suggests that while the central bank is likely to provide sufficient liquidity – both transient and durable — to the system, it has abstained from providing a liquidity bonanza. Therefore, lingering pressures on liquidity could weigh on the transmission process for now.
The pressure on liquidity conditions is anticipated to linger on as we move into the end of the month and year-end drags including advance tax outflows weigh in. We expect this to be met by appropriate liquidity infusion measures including further OMOs, buy/sell swaps, and longer-duration repos.
The RBI showed confidence in the disinflation process, pegging the inflation rate to average at 4.2% in FY26 while growth is projected to be at 6.7% — which is towards the higher end of the range set out in the economic survey of 6.3-6.8% for FY26.
The governor set out a more balanced approach towards regulations which would strike a balance between the associated benefits and costs. However, it fell short of providing any clarity on the implementation of the new LCR norms.
We expect the RBI to frontload its rate cuts and deliver another rate cut in the April policy of 25bps. The space for rate cuts beyond this would hinge on how domestic and global headwinds pan out.

Akzo Nobel India announces Q3 and 9M financial results for 2024-25

Mumbai, February 7, 2025, the Board of Directors of Akzo Nobel India Limited, a leading paints and coatings company and maker of Dulux Paints, approved the financial results for the quarter and nine months ended 31 December 2024.
Highlights
Q3 FY25* (compared with Q3 FY24**)
- Revenue from operations at ₹1,050.5 crore, up by 2%
- EBIT from operations at ₹143.5 crore, down by 2%
- PAT at ₹108.6 crore, down by 5%
- 9M FY25 (compared with 9M FY24)
- Revenue from operations at ₹3,069.1 crore, up by 3%
- EBIT from operations at ₹414.8 crore, up by 1%
- PAT at ₹321.1 crore, up by 1%
Akzo Nobel India Limited Chairman and Managing Director, Rajiv Rajgopal, commented:
“In Q3 FY25, we achieved both volume and value growth despite subdued market conditions. Favorable demand in infrastructure, power, mining, marine, and real estate sectors fueled sustained B2B momentum in paints and coatings. Prudent cost management protected profitability, effectively mitigating the impact of raw material inflation on margins.
Overall, our performance in 9M FY25 reflects continued growth and strong double-digit profitability trajectory with market share gains.”
